In Matthew 19:16-22 there is a dialogue between the rich young man and Jesus. This young man asks Jesus how he can obtain eternal life, and Jesus gives a direct answer, “keep the commandments” .And this man goes on to ask “which?”(And personally I believe by which he actually meant the ceremonial/moral law) And as Jesus mentions these commandments you realize that they are identical to those found in Exodus 20:3-17.Now, tell me, do you think Jesus is so “messed up” that He’ll say this and then inspire Paul, to write that, this SAME LAW, has been nailed to the cross? Do you really think that Jesus who loves you so much and died so that you could have eternal life will expect the young man to keep ALL THE 10 C0MMANDMENTS to obtain eternal life, BUT NOT YOU? Do you really think Jesus, who loves you, would fool you into keeping nine commandments out of 10 and then go back and say :Keeping 9 commandments out of 10 avails to NOTHING ( James 2:10-11)?Clearly, the Sabbath does matter, as the other nine commandments. Let’s be honest for once, why would the seventh day Sabbath that was instituted before sin (Genesis 2:1-3), be nailed to the cross or be transferred to the first day of the week when it has such significance? God’s Law is not directly proportional to circumstances. It stays the same, and so does God (Malachi 3:6).Sin did not change God’s LAW. God’s law still remains the same. That’s why Jesus died, because God’s law cannot be changed.
